A teenager who drove while uninsured has been fined.
18 year old Joshua Craine of Richmond Hill in Douglas appeared before magistrates at Douglas Courthouse.
He admitted having no insurance in his Subaru Impreza on Richmond Hill in Douglas on January 26.
He was fined £650, given five penalty points and ordered to pay £50 prosecution costs.
